Summary

The remote host is missing an update for the 'buildah' package(s) announced via the FEDORA-2022-e6388650ea advisory.

Insight

Insight

The buildah package provides a command line tool which can be used to * create a working container from scratch or * create a working container from an image as a starting point * mount/umount a working container&#39, s root file system for manipulation * save container&#39, s root file system layer to create a new image * delete a working container or an image

Affected Software

Affected Software

'buildah' package(s) on Fedora 34.
